Transaction 54bb825166013f1aecf66ce78a0bd90f07a81ba68013c63eb768fd7b77b3b161
1 Input
1 Output
-
54bb825166013f1aecf66ce78a0bd90f07a81ba68013c63eb768fd7b77b3b161:0
- value
- 575980000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 feb4cf0e8fa6e28acbb3b6ead4cc561289b38f27 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1QDmEYRGvjGaeTQcYTdyqRXsQRF7qCU7nr